Ingestible animal temperature sensor
First Claim
1. An ingestible bolus for ingestion in a stomach of a ruminant animal, comprising:
- a housing including two housing halves, each of said halves comprised of a biologically inert material, each of said housing halves consisting essentially of plastic;
a plurality of electrical components disposed within said housing, said electrical components including a power source, an air-borne signal transmitter for transmitting a data burst, and an antenna connected with said transmitter, said antenna disposed entirely within one said plastic housing half; and
means for ballasting said housing with a weight sufficient to maintain said bolus within the stomach of the ruminant animal, said ballasting means being disposed entirely within an other said plastic housing half, said ballasting means including a ferric metal material.

Abstract
A system and ingestible boluses for monitoring physiological parameters of animals. The boluses include circuitry for storing a selectable identification code, for sensing a physiological parameter, and for transmitting a data burst signal which includes information corresponding to the identification code and a sensed physiological parameter. In addition to the boluses, the system includes a receiver for receiving data burst signals transmitted from the boluses. According to one mode of operation, the bolus transmits data burst continuously at a preselected rate. The receiver can be coupled to a processor which can process data from the data burst signals.
